Official abstract text for this publication.
A resin composition is based on a resin chosen from the group consisting of unsaturated polyester resins and vinyl ester resins, a crosslinking initiator and a crosslinking agent of general formula R1—X—R2, in which X is an optionally substituted alkylene group and R1 and R2 are, independently of one another, an acrylate, methacrylate or vinyl group, an alkenyl group bearing an unsaturated carbon at the chain end, or an alkynyl group bearing an unsaturated carbon at the chain end.

The invention claimed is: 1. A tire comprising a resin composition based on: a resin selected from the group consisting of vinyl ester resins; a crosslinking initiator; and a crosslinking agent of general formula (I) R 1 —X—R 2 (I) in which: X is an optionally substituted alkylene group, and R 1 and R 2 are, independently of one another, an acrylate group, methacrylate group, vinyl group, alkenyl group bearing an unsaturated carbon at the chain end, or alkynyl group bearing an unsaturated carbon at the chain end. 2. The tire according to claim 1 , wherein the resin is an epoxy vinyl ester resin based on novolac, bisphenol, or novolac and bisphenol. 3. The tire according to claim 1 , wherein the X group is substituted by at least one group selected from hydroxyl, ether, alkyl and dialkylamine groups. 4. The tire according to claim 1 , wherein the X group is not substituted. 5. The tire according to claim 1 , wherein a main chain of the X group comprises from 1 to 4 carbon atoms. 6. The tire according to claim 1 , wherein R 1 and R 2 are independently selected from the group consisting of acrylate, methacrylate, vinyl, allyl and ethynyl groups. 7. The tire according to claim 1 , wherein the crosslinking initiator is a radical initiator selected from the group consisting of halogenated compounds, compounds comprising an azo group, and peroxide compounds. 8. The tire according to claim 1 , wherein the crosslinking initiator is selected from the group consisting of azobisisobutyronitrile and peroxides. 9. The tire according to claim 1 , wherein the crosslinking initiator is a photoinitiator sensitive to UV above 300 nm. 10. The tire according to claim 1 , wherein the resin composition comprises from 0.5% to 3% by weight of crosslinking initiator. 11. The tire according to claim 1 , wherein the resin composition comprises from 2% to 15% by weight of crosslinking agent of general formula (I).
